Post Re: PD trim motor just clicks
If you put the solenoids, you can put any $10 rocker switch on it and can get them at basically any hardware store. Not as easy with the other switch. Plus by using the solenoid, the solenoid takes all the load, not the switch, so the pump gets full load.
